11 Care Home Beneficiaries Pass Tawjihi Exam, Says Minister

Amman: The Ministry of Social Development has announced that 11 male and female students from its care homes have successfully passed the General Secondary Education Certificate Examination (Tawjihi) for the 2024-2025 academic year.

According to Jordan News Agency, Minister of Social Development Wafa Bani Mustafa congratulated the students on their success. She noted that this achievement enables them to pursue higher education and serves as a testament to their perseverance, diligence, and relentless efforts.

Bani Mustafa expressed the ministry’s pride in the students’ accomplishments and committed to supporting them in continuing their education to fulfill their aspirations. This support aligns with the Royal directives and is overseen by His Royal Highness Crown Prince Al Hussein bin Abdullah II.

The minister also highlighted that the Kingdom’s care homes aim to provide necessary services and support to help students overcome challenges and achieve success. She acknowledged the crucial role played by the care homes’ staff in assisting these students in reaching their goals.
